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$223.62 | 5.418% | $235.7357 | $235.74 | $235.75 | $235.70 |
Purchase #2 | $42.26 | 12.787% | $47.6638 | $47.66 | $47.65 | $47.70 |
Purchase #3 | $199.52 | 3.690% | $206.8823 | $206.88 | $206.90 | $206.90 |
Purchase #4 | $37.76 | 6.240% | $40.1162 | $40.12 | $40.10 | $40.10 |
Purchase #5 | $250.95 | 13.650% | $285.2047 | $285.20 | $285.20 | $285.20 |
Purchase #6 | $48.88 | 4.265% | $50.9647 | $50.96 | $50.95 | $51.00 |
Purchase #7 | $167.98 | 5.159% | $176.6461 | $176.65 | $176.65 | $176.60 |
7 purchase totals = | $970.97 | $1,043.2135 | $1,043.21 | $1,043.20 | $1,043.20 |
